Rezidor SAS report a rise in turnover

An increase in revenue per available room of 11% has led to strongly improved results for hotel operator, Rezidor SAS Hospitality.

The group, which operates the Radisson, Regent, Park Inn and Country Inn brands reported turnover of €587m (£401m) and pre-tax profit of €31.6m (£21.6m) for 2005.

This compares with turnover of €498.7m (£341m) and profit of €4.2m (£2.87m) the previous year.

The group signed 29 new hotel contracts and opened 37 new properties last year, as well as agreeing a worldwide licence agreement with fashion house Missoni.

This growth strategy, according to president and chief executive Kurt Ritter, is one of the company's "biggest assets".

Three-quarters of the group is owned by the SAS Group, while the remaining 25% is owned by Carlson Hotels Worldwide.
